February 25, 2009  — Most often when you hear of a ballplayer going to Japan, he’s near (or at) the end of his MLB career. Occasionally, a younger player gets the chance to experience yakyuu. One such ballplayer this season is Chase Lambin, infielder for Triple-A Albuquerque in 2008, who recently signed with the Chiba Lotte Marines, managed by Bobby Valentine.

Lambin dubs his whirlwind, nine-day tryout the “Magical Mystery Tour” and chronicles his adventures, complete with photos, smiles and happy ending at a couple sites:  Clubhouse Gas and New York Future Stars.  It’s a fun read, in large part because of his boundless enthusiasm, which includes his willingness to faithfully log in each day of the nine with the latest news about his trip.

I refrained from posting my favorite quote, because it would be completely misunderstood when read out of context. So we will all have to to settle for second place:

Up at 7 a.m. for my 10:45 international flight. Get to the terminal with plenty of time to spare and the Continental worker asks where I am headed. I stick out my chest, with a big smile, and say, “Tokyo!” like she should be impressed. I guess she wasn’t because she looked at me like I was an idiot. (I guess other people in the world fly to Japan besides me).
